AUTONOMOUS TRANSMISSION CONFIGURATION UPDATING

    Abstract: Methods, systems, and devices for wireless communications are described that allow secondary cell (SCell) beam failure recovery using a primary cell (PCell). A user equipment (UE) may transmit, via the PCell, an indication of a beam failure of the SCell in a scheduling request (SR) or in a dedicated SR message. After receiving the indication, the base station may request a report from the UE or alternatively, may monitor a set of resources for a report without transmitting a request to the UE. The report may be transmitted via the PCell and may include an indication of a selected beam to use for subsequent communications on the SCell. Based on the report, the base station may modify its transmission configuration for the SCell and communicate with the UE via the selected beam.

    Abstract: Methods, systems, and devices for wireless communications are described that provide for power control for dual connectivity. A UE may identify a power control configuration that determines priorities for uplink transmissions over multiple component carriers and one or more base stations. The UE may identify a union of semi-static uplink or flexible transmissions between multiple component carriers employed by one cell group, such as a master cell group and a secondary cell group, and determine a configured power level for the cell group. The UE may then determine whether to transmit an uplink transmission on a cell of another cell group, based on the power control configuration and the configured power level.

    Abstract: Apparatus, methods, and computer-readable media for providing improved power efficiency during DRX wake-up are disclosed. An example method of wireless communication at a UE includes receiving a WUS from a base station while performing a DRX cycle, the WUS indicating data for transmission to the UE. The example method also includes at least one receiving a downlink reference signal or transmitting an uplink reference signal based on the WUS and prior to reception of the data, the uplink reference signal transmitted or the downlink reference signal received during an on-duration of the DRX cycle and in response to receiving the WUS. The example method also includes sending a CSI report to the base station based on the WUS and prior to the receiving of the data. The example method also includes receiving the data following the respective receiving or transmitting of the downlink reference signal or uplink reference signal.

    Abstract: In one aspect of the disclosure, a method, a computer-readable medium, and an apparatus are provided to reduce overhead at the expense of increasing latency for UEs with weak link gain, while latency for most UEs may remain the same. The apparatus may be a UE. The apparatus may transmit a RACH preamble to a base station in one or more attempts. The apparatus may receive, through a random access response message from the base station, information including the number of attempts the base station uses to decode the RACH preamble. The apparatus may adjust the transmission power for the connection request message according to the number of attempts the base station uses to decode the RACH preamble. The apparatus may transmit the connection request message using the adjusted transmission power.

    Abstract: Methods, systems, and devices for wireless communication are described. A user equipment (UE) may identify a number of beam directions that satisfy a transmission power condition. The UE may select a beam direction for a random access signal by choosing one of the beam directions that satisfies additional criteria, such as transmitting a random access message at the next opportunity. The transmission power may be selected based on a target receive power and a path loss for the selected beam. In some cases, if the sum of the path loss for a beam direction and the target receive power exceeds a maximum transmission power by more than a predetermined amount, the random access signal will not be transmitted using that beam. In some cases, if a response to the random access is not received, a different beam direction may be selected, the transmission power may be increased, or both.
